Pork Schnitzel

Pork Schnitzel

Rating: star_offstar_offstar_offstar_offstar_off
Prep Time: 20 Minutes
Cook Time: 10 Minutes

Pork loin cut and pounded then placed in seasoned flour, in egg wash then back in bread crumbs. Deep fry at 350 degrees til deep brown. Serve with a buttery mushroom gravy.
